Smooth muscle is grouped into two types: single-unit smooth muscle, also known as visceral smooth muscle, and multiunit smooth muscle. Most smooth muscle is of the single-unit type, and is found in the walls of most internal organs (viscera); and lines blood vessels (except large elastic arteries), the urinary tract , and the digestive tract .

Epaxial and hypaxial muscles. In adult vertebrates, trunk muscles can be broadly divided into hypaxial muscles, which lie ventral to the horizontal septum of the vertebrae and epaxial muscles, which lie dorsal to the septum. [1] Hypaxial muscles include some vertebral muscles, the diaphragm, the abdominal muscles, and all limb muscles.

Sartorius muscle. Muscles of the right leg, viewed from the front. (Rectus femoris removed to reveal the vastus intermedius.) The sartorius muscle (/ sɑːrˈtɔːriəs /) is the longest muscle in the human body. [2] It is a long, thin, superficial muscle that runs down the length of the thigh in the anterior compartment.
The muscular system is an organ system consisting of skeletal, smooth, and cardiac muscle. It permits movement of the body, maintains posture, and circulates blood throughout the body. [1] The muscular systems in vertebrates are controlled through the nervous system although some muscles (such as the cardiac muscle) can be completely autonomous.

The external oblique is situated on the lateral and anterior parts of the abdomen. It is broad, thin, and irregularly quadrilateral, its muscular portion occupying the side, its aponeurosis the anterior wall of the abdomen. In most humans, the oblique is not visible, due to subcutaneous fat deposits and the small size of the muscle.
